What you'll learn

  • Build a complete project-based BIM model in Revit from architecture to structure and MEP.
  • Set up a professional Revit project with levels, worksharing, linked files, DWG imports, and coordination workflows.
  • Model architectural BIM elements including walls, floors, ceilings, stairs, ramps, openings, finishes, and detailed project components.
  • Create high-detail finish modeling workflows using materials, wall sweeps, keynotes, ceiling details, and Revit assemblies.
  • Develop structural BIM models with foundations, columns, beams, piles, joists, T-beam components, and structural families.
  • Work with rebar modeling, structural schedules, detailing workflows, and SOFiSTiK reinforcement tools.
  • Model MEP systems in Revit including rainwater, sanitary drainage, fire protection, piping, fittings, and mechanical rooms.
  • Use Dynamo to automate Revit workflows such as schedules, tagging, zoning, model transfer, and data export.
  • Coordinate BIM models with Navisworks using clash detection, model comparison, reports, quantification, and 4D simulation.
  • Learn real project workflows, practical BIM techniques, and professional coordination methods used across multi-discipline projects.
